Hansen, killer of 'Chain Saw Massacre,' dies
Gunnar Hansen
A spokesman says Gunnar Hansen, who played the iconic villain Leatherface in the original “Texas Chain Saw Massacre,” died Saturday at his home in Maine. He was 68.
Hansen starred in the 1974 film that has become a classic among horror-movie aficionados and spawned a series of sequels. In the movie, friends visiting their grandfather’s house are hunted by Leatherface, a chain-saw wielding killer.
Hansen’s character in the movie “is one of the most iconic evil figures in the history of cinema,” said his agent, Mike Eisenstadt.
Eisenstadt says in 2013 Hansen published his book “Chain Saw Confidential,” which gave readers a behind-the-scenes look.
